What is a finance multi-tenant SaaS analytics model and why does it matter to executives?
A finance multi-tenant SaaS analytics model is a structured way to collect, govern, and present recurring revenue data across many customers, business units, partners, or product lines within one platform. For executives, its value is simple: it turns disconnected billing, CRM, ERP, product usage, and customer success signals into a single operating view of revenue quality. Instead of seeing only top-line MRR or ARR, leadership can understand which tenants are growing, which segments are eroding margin, where onboarding delays are slowing activation, and how churn risk is affecting future cash flow. In subscription businesses, visibility is not just a reporting need; it is a control system for pricing, retention, expansion, and capital allocation.
Why do traditional finance dashboards fail in recurring revenue businesses?
Traditional dashboards often fail because they were designed for periodic accounting, not continuous subscription operations. They summarize booked revenue after the fact, but they do not explain the drivers behind renewals, downgrades, failed payments, usage shifts, partner performance, or tenant-level support costs. In a multi-tenant environment, this gap becomes larger because one shared platform may serve direct customers, channel partners, white-label resellers, and internal business units with different pricing models and service obligations. Executives need analytics that reflect the economics of recurring revenue, not just the mechanics of general ledger reporting.

What metrics create true executive visibility across recurring revenue streams?
Executive visibility comes from linking financial metrics to lifecycle and operational context. MRR and ARR remain essential, but they are not enough on their own. Leaders also need gross and net revenue retention, logo churn, expansion revenue, average revenue per account, onboarding time to value, failed payment rates, support burden by tenant, and gross margin by segment. The goal is not to create more metrics; it is to connect each metric to a decision. For example, if expansion is strong but margin is falling, the issue may be service intensity or infrastructure inefficiency rather than pricing. If churn is concentrated in one onboarding cohort, the problem may sit with implementation quality rather than product fit.
How should executives organize recurring revenue KPIs for decision-making?
A practical approach is to group KPIs into four layers: revenue performance, customer lifecycle, operational efficiency, and risk. Revenue performance covers MRR, ARR, retention, expansion, and contraction. Customer lifecycle includes activation, onboarding completion, adoption, and customer success engagement. Operational efficiency measures billing accuracy, support cost, infrastructure cost, and automation coverage. Risk includes concentration exposure, payment failure trends, compliance exceptions, and data quality issues. This structure helps executives move from observation to action without getting lost in dashboard sprawl.
| KPI Layer | Executive Question | Example Metrics |
|---|---|---|
| Revenue performance | Is recurring revenue growing with quality? | MRR, ARR, expansion revenue, gross revenue retention, net revenue retention |
| Customer lifecycle | Are customers reaching value and staying engaged? | Onboarding completion, time to value, adoption rate, renewal readiness |
| Operational efficiency | Are we delivering revenue efficiently? | Billing accuracy, support cost per tenant, infrastructure cost by segment, automation rate |
| Risk and governance | Where could revenue or trust be exposed? | Failed payments, concentration risk, compliance exceptions, data freshness |

How should the architecture be designed for secure and scalable finance analytics?
The right architecture starts with a governed data model, not a dashboard tool. In most enterprise SaaS environments, the analytics stack should ingest data from billing systems, CRM, ERP, product telemetry, support platforms, and identity systems through an API-first integration layer. A cloud-native design often uses PostgreSQL for structured financial and tenant metadata, Redis where low-latency caching is needed, and containerized services on Kubernetes or Docker for scalable processing. The critical design principle is tenant-aware data modeling: every event, invoice, subscription, entitlement, and support interaction must be attributable to the correct tenant, product, partner, and time period. Without that discipline, executive reporting becomes unreliable regardless of the visualization layer.
How do tenant isolation and executive reporting coexist?
They coexist through policy-driven aggregation. Tenant isolation should protect operational and customer-specific data, while the analytics layer exposes only the level of aggregation each role is authorized to see. Identity and Access Management controls, row-level security, and role-based reporting are essential. A CFO may need cross-tenant margin visibility, while a partner manager should see only the tenants under that partner. This is not just a security issue; it is a trust issue. If stakeholders doubt the governance model, they will revert to offline reporting and the platform loses authority.
What data model best supports recurring revenue analysis across tenants?
The most effective model combines tenant, subscription, contract, invoice, payment, product usage, support activity, and customer lifecycle entities into a common analytical schema. The design should support both point-in-time reporting and trend analysis. Executives need to see current ARR, but they also need cohort movement, renewal behavior, and margin shifts over time. A strong model also separates booked, billed, collected, and recognized views of revenue so finance can maintain accuracy while business leaders still get operational insight. This distinction is especially important in businesses with annual contracts, monthly billing, usage-based charges, or partner revenue sharing.
Which dimensions matter most for segmentation?
The most useful dimensions are tenant, product line, pricing model, acquisition channel, partner, geography, industry, customer size, lifecycle stage, and service tier. These dimensions allow leaders to compare not just revenue totals but revenue quality. For example, a segment with lower ARR may still be strategically stronger if it has faster onboarding, lower support cost, and better retention. Segmentation is where analytics becomes strategy rather than accounting.
How can organizations measure tenant profitability without distorting the picture?
Tenant profitability should be measured as a management view, not as a simplistic accounting shortcut. The model should allocate direct costs such as infrastructure consumption, premium support effort, implementation services, and partner commissions where they are materially attributable. Shared platform costs should be allocated carefully and transparently, with clear rules that executives understand. The objective is not perfect precision; it is decision-grade insight. If a tenant appears unprofitable because onboarding is unusually long or support is highly manual, leadership can decide whether to automate, reprice, redesign service tiers, or exit the segment.
| Profitability Input | Why It Matters | Executive Use |
|---|---|---|
| Recurring revenue by tenant | Establishes baseline value and trend | Prioritize retention and expansion focus |
| Infrastructure and platform cost | Shows delivery efficiency by segment | Guide architecture and pricing decisions |
| Support and success effort | Reveals service intensity | Adjust service tiers or automation strategy |
| Partner or channel economics | Clarifies net contribution | Refine partner incentives and route-to-market |
What implementation roadmap reduces risk and accelerates business value?
The safest roadmap is phased. Start by defining executive decisions, then standardize KPI definitions, then integrate the minimum viable data sources needed to answer those decisions. After that, build role-based dashboards, automate data quality checks, and expand into predictive use cases such as churn risk or renewal forecasting. This sequence matters because many analytics programs fail by starting with broad data ingestion before agreeing on business logic. A smaller, governed first release creates trust and gives finance and operations a common language.
What should the first 90 days focus on?
The first 90 days should focus on KPI governance, source system mapping, tenant identity normalization, and one executive dashboard that combines MRR, ARR, retention, billing health, and segment performance. This is also the right stage to define ownership across finance, product, customer success, and platform engineering. How should companies approach migration from fragmented reporting to a unified model?
Migration should be treated as a business change program, not just a technical project. Start by inventorying current reports, definitions, and manual workarounds. Then identify which reports are authoritative, which are redundant, and which should be retired. During transition, run old and new reporting in parallel long enough to validate KPI consistency and explain differences. This parallel period is essential because recurring revenue metrics often vary due to timing logic, contract amendments, or billing exceptions. A disciplined migration reduces political resistance and protects executive confidence.
What common mistakes slow migration or damage trust?
The most common mistakes are changing KPI definitions without governance, ignoring data lineage, underestimating tenant mapping complexity, and launching dashboards before reconciliation is complete. Another mistake is treating finance analytics as a finance-only initiative. In subscription businesses, product usage, onboarding, support, and customer success all influence revenue outcomes. If those teams are excluded, the model will explain what happened financially but not why it happened operationally.
- Do not merge data sources until tenant identifiers, contract logic, and billing events are normalized.
- Do not publish executive dashboards until finance and operating teams agree on metric definitions and refresh rules.
What operational controls keep the analytics model reliable over time?
Reliability depends on observability, governance, and ownership. Data pipelines should be monitored for freshness, completeness, schema drift, and failed transformations. Logging and alerting should identify when billing events stop flowing, when usage data spikes unexpectedly, or when tenant mappings break. Governance should define who owns each KPI, who approves logic changes, and how exceptions are documented. Compliance and security controls should ensure that sensitive financial and tenant data is accessed only by authorized roles. In practice, the analytics model becomes part of the operating platform, not a side project.
How do platform engineering and finance teams work together effectively?
They work best when finance defines decision requirements and control points while platform engineering defines service reliability, integration patterns, and access controls. Finance should not be forced to own pipeline operations, and engineering should not define revenue logic in isolation. A shared operating model with clear service levels, change management, and issue escalation creates the discipline needed for executive-grade reporting.
What trade-offs should leaders evaluate before choosing a model?
The main trade-offs are speed versus governance, flexibility versus standardization, and shared efficiency versus tenant-specific customization. A highly customized reporting model may satisfy every stakeholder initially but becomes expensive to maintain and difficult to trust. A heavily standardized model is easier to scale but may not capture partner-specific or white-label economics without thoughtful extensions. Leaders should also weigh centralized analytics against dedicated environments for regulated or strategically sensitive tenants. The right answer depends on growth stage, compliance obligations, partner strategy, and operating complexity.
What decision criteria matter most at the executive level?
Executives should evaluate whether the model improves forecast confidence, shortens time to insight, supports pricing and retention decisions, reduces manual reconciliation, and scales with new products or channels. If a proposed design is technically elegant but does not improve these outcomes, it is not the right investment. The best analytics model is the one that changes decisions for the better.
